Immunologic Effects Of Vitamin D On Human Health And Disease

Vitamin D, also known as the sunshine vitamin, is a fat-soluble vitamin that plays an essential role in maintaining bone health. However, recent research has shown that vitamin D also has significant immunologic effects on human health and disease.

What is Vitamin D?

Vitamin D is produced when the skin is exposed to sunlight. It can also be obtained through diet or supplements. Once in the body, vitamin D is converted into its active form, which is necessary for its immunologic effects.

The Immunologic Effects of Vitamin D

Vitamin D has been shown to have several immunologic effects on the body, including:

  • Regulation of immune cell proliferation and differentiation
  • Modulation of cytokine production
  • Enhancement of the innate immune system
  • Suppression of the adaptive immune system

These effects have been shown to play a role in the prevention and treatment of several diseases.

Vitamin D and Autoimmune Diseases

Autoimmune diseases occur when the immune system attacks healthy cells in the body. Vitamin D has been shown to have a suppressive effect on the adaptive immune system, which may help prevent autoimmune diseases.

Several studies have shown that low levels of vitamin D are associated with an increased risk of autoimmune diseases, such as multiple sclerosis, rheumatoid arthritis, and lupus.

Vitamin D and Infectious Diseases

Vitamin D has also been shown to play a role in the prevention and treatment of infectious diseases.

Studies have shown that vitamin D supplementation can reduce the risk of respiratory tract infections, such as the flu and pneumonia. Vitamin D has also been shown to have antimicrobial properties, which may help fight off bacterial and viral infections.

Vitamin D and Cancer

Vitamin D has been shown to have anti-cancer properties, particularly in the prevention and treatment of colon, breast, and prostate cancer.

Studies have shown that individuals with higher levels of vitamin D have a lower risk of developing these types of cancer. Vitamin D has also been shown to inhibit the growth and spread of cancer cells.
